Term 1′s Theme: Next Generation Technology

Maximising the potential of iPads, learner response systems, 1:1 devices and exciting new online spaces with your interactive whiteboard.

The nature of technology use in the classroom is changing rapidly with the introduction of 1:1 devices, iPads and learner response systems to complement our use of the interactive whiteboard.  This user group focuses on sharing the latest applications and techniques that enable the connections between the different technologies and put the learning in the hands of the learner.  The session will include ActivInspire skills that can be used straight away with any online learning environment.

A typical User Group session will include:

  • Teacher lesson presentations
  • New skill instruction and hands on practice
  • Did you know?
  • Question and answer session
